TerrellFlyer has you on the right track with regard to CG. Balance with tank empty and the NOSE should slightly drop.

For flight times, I use a simple kitchen timer or watch with a count down timer. Determine how many minutes your plane will run at FULL THROTTLE then subtract a minute. This gives you ample reserve if you need to go around or cannot land due to traffic.
